About NYRR
New York Road Runners (NYRR) was founded in 1958 when a small group of passionate runners vowed to bring running to the people, andhas grown from a local running club into the world’s premier community running organization. NYRR’s mission is to help and inspire through running, aiming to empower people of all ages and abilities to improve their health and well-being through the power of running and fitness.
NYRR’s year-round offerings of races, community events, programs, and training resources provide hundreds of thousands of people with the motivation, know-how, and opportunities to start running and keep running for life. NYRR’s premier event, the famed TCS New York City Marathon, attracts the world’s top professional runners and committed amateurs alike, while also raising millions of dollars annually for charity and driving economic impact for New York City. NYRR is equally committed to the runners of tomorrow, passionately providing youth fitness programs that educate and inspire children in underserved communities in New York City, nationwide, and around the world.
Headquartered in New York City, NYRR is a 501(c)(3) organization. To learn more, please visit www.nyrr.org.

About the Department
The Business Development and Strategic Partnerships team securesand manages mission-aligned partnerships providing revenue, value-in-kind and strategic support for advancing NYRR's mission. The team collaborates across NYRR departments to maximize partnership value and runner engagement through strategic programming. Additionally, the department oversees licensing of NYRR IP rights, including production of co-branded productand apparel.
About the Position
Reporting to the Headof Licensing and Strategic Partnerships, the Specialist is a key project manager on the team, supporting corporate and licensee management, vendor relationships,partnership collaborationsand other organizational and departmental initiatives. The Specialist assistsin all day-to-day operations of the department including licensee relationship management;development, approvalsand marketingof co-branded product; planning and executing licensee deliverables; vendor management, and budget tracking. In addition to working with NYRR’s partner licensees, the Specialist collaborates with NYRR’s Human Resources, Development and Events departments to manage orders for all staff uniforms, and race/event premiums. The position requires some work on evenings and weekends, to supervise partner-sponsored programs at the NYRR RunCenterfeaturing the New Balance RunHuband NYRR racesand special events. The ideal candidate can multi-task effectively; is an organized project manager; has experience managing licensee accounts and related cross functional projects, has strong communicationskills and possessesa strong understanding of product licensingand brand compliance.
